So lösen Sie verstümmelte chinesische Github-Zeichen
GitHub, als eine der weltweit größten Open-Source-Code-Hosting-Plattformen, hat in den letzten Jahren mit seinem chinesischen verstümmelten Problem viel Aufmerksamkeit und Diskussionen auf sich gezogen. Aufgrund seiner globalen Nutzungseigenschaften, an denen viele Programmierer und Entwickler beteiligt sind, nehmen auch die Auswirkungen des Problems verstümmelter chinesischer Zeichen zu. Dieser Artikel beginnt mit den Ursachen, Lösungen und Praktiken verstümmelter chinesischer Schriftzeichen und versucht, die Natur und Lösung dieses Problems zu untersuchen.
1. Gründe für chinesische verstümmelte Codes
Chinesische verstümmelte Codes bedeuten, dass chinesische Schriftzeichen unter bestimmten Umständen nicht normal angezeigt und gelesen werden können und ungewöhnliche Phänomene wie verstümmelte Codes, Kästchen, Muster usw. auftreten. In GitHub stammen die Quellen chinesischer verstümmelter Zeichen hauptsächlich aus den folgenden zwei Aspekten.
- Nichtübereinstimmung des Codierungsformats
In verschiedenen Betriebssystemen und Softwareanwendungen sind unterschiedliche Zeichencodierungsformate beteiligt. Wenn das Kodierungsformat der Textdatei bei Verwendung von GitHub nicht mit dem Standardkodierungsformat der Softwareanwendung oder des Systems übereinstimmt, führt dies zu einer abnormalen Anzeige von chinesischem Text. Zu den gängigen Kodierungsformaten gehören UTF-8, GBK, GB2312 usw. Sie müssen je nach Situation das geeignete Kodierungsformat auswählen.
- Interferenzen durch Sonderzeichen
In chinesischen Texten können einige Sonderzeichen Codierungsstörungen verursachen. Beispielsweise können chinesische Klammern, Anführungszeichen, Bindestriche usw. aufgrund ihrer unterschiedlichen Ausdrücke in unterschiedlichen Kodierungsformaten leicht Probleme wie verstümmelte Zeichen verursachen.
2. Lösungen für verstümmelte chinesische Schriftzeichen
Es gibt viele Lösungen für das Problem verstümmelter chinesischer Schriftzeichen.
- Kodierungsformat ändern
Wie bereits erwähnt, haben unterschiedliche Kodierungsformate Auswirkungen auf die Anzeige von chinesischem Text. Wenn daher ein Problem mit verstümmelten chinesischen Zeichen auftritt, können Sie versuchen, das Codierungsformat der Datei zu ändern. Wenn Sie beispielsweise das Windows-System verwenden, müssen Sie das Dateicodierungsformat in UTF-8 ändern, da das Standardcodierungsformat GBK und das Standardcodierungsformat in GitHub UTF-8 ist Es kann ordnungsgemäß in GitHub funktionieren und chinesischen Text anzeigen.
- Verwenden Sie Transkodierungstools
Wenn Sie Schwierigkeiten haben, das Kodierungsformat manuell zu ändern, können Sie auch einige Transkodierungstools zum Konvertieren der Dateien verwenden. iconv ist beispielsweise ein Transkodierungstool, das in Betriebssystemen wie Linux und Unix verwendet werden kann. Es kann Dateien durch einfache Befehlszeilenoperationen von einem Kodierungsformat in ein anderes konvertieren.
- Es werden keine Sonderzeichen verwendet
Um Codierungsstörungen durch Sonderzeichen zu vermeiden, vermeiden Sie während des Schreibvorgangs die Verwendung von Sonderzeichen wie chinesischen Klammern, Anführungszeichen und Bindestrichen. Wenn Sie diese Zeichen verwenden müssen, können Sie stattdessen die Verwendung von Zeichen voller Breite in Betracht ziehen oder das Codierungsformat dieser Zeichen konvertieren.
3. Das Problem der verstümmelten chinesischen Schriftzeichen in der Praxis
Obwohl das Problem der verstümmelten chinesischen Schriftzeichen schon immer große Aufmerksamkeit erregt hat, ist es in der tatsächlichen Entwicklung und Verwendung immer noch schwierig zu vermeiden. In GitHub kommen auch häufig chinesische verstümmelte Zeichen vor. Wenn Sie beispielsweise den Befehl „git clone“ zum Herunterladen eines chinesischen Projekts verwenden, können Probleme mit verstümmelten chinesischen Zeichen auftreten. Wenn Sie den Befehl „git merge“ zum Zusammenführen von Codes verwenden, können auch Probleme wie die nicht ordnungsgemäße Anzeige chinesischer Dateinamen auftreten.
Um diese Probleme zu lösen, können wir die folgenden Maßnahmen ergreifen:
- Versuchen Sie, das UTF-8-Kodierungsformat zu verwenden.
Als plattformübergreifendes Kodierungsformat hat sich UTF-8 nach und nach zum am häufigsten verwendeten Kodierungsformat entwickelt in GitHub. Versuchen Sie daher beim Schreiben und Senden von Code, das UTF-8-Kodierungsformat zu verwenden, um die Wahrscheinlichkeit verstümmelter chinesischer Zeichen zu verringern.
- Kodierungsformat löschen
Wenn Sie Git Clone, Git Fetch und andere Befehle zum Herunterladen von Code verwenden, können Sie das Problem verstümmelter chinesischer Zeichen lösen, indem Sie das Kodierungsformat angeben. Wenn Sie beispielsweise den Befehl „git clone“ verwenden, um ein chinesisches Projekt herunterzuladen, können Sie den Parameter „?encoding=UTF-8“ nach der URL hinzufügen, um die Verwendung des UTF-8-Codierungsformats zu erzwingen.
- Git-Client verwenden
Für Entwickler, die keinen Github-Client verwenden und den SSH-Schlüssel nicht konfiguriert haben, können Sie den Git-Client über MSYSgit unter Windows installieren, da dies intuitiver und einfacher ist verwenden und können einige schwierige Probleme vermeiden, wie z. B. Probleme bei der Anzeige chinesischer Dateipfade in Git-Projekten und Probleme bei der SSH-Sicherheitsauthentifizierung.
Kurz gesagt, das Problem der verstümmelten chinesischen Schriftzeichen ist in Github ein relativ häufiges Problem, aber nicht schwer zu lösen. Solange wir auf das Codierungsformat achten, Sonderzeicheninterferenzen vermeiden und einen geeigneten Git-Client auswählen, können wir das Problem verstümmelter chinesischer Zeichen vermeiden und die Github-Plattform problemlos nutzen.
Das obige ist der detaillierte Inhalt vonSo lösen Sie verstümmelte chinesische Github-Zeichen.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Heiße KI -Werkzeuge

Undresser.AI Undress
KI-gestützte App zum Erstellen realistischer Aktfotos

AI Clothes Remover
Online-KI-Tool zum Entfernen von Kleidung aus Fotos.

Undress AI Tool
Ausziehbilder kostenlos

Clothoff.io
KI-Kleiderentferner

AI Hentai Generator
Erstellen Sie kostenlos Ai Hentai.

Heißer Artikel

Heiße Werkzeuge

Notepad++7.3.1
Einfach zu bedienender und kostenloser Code-Editor

SublimeText3 chinesische Version
Chinesische Version, sehr einfach zu bedienen

Senden Sie Studio 13.0.1
Leistungsstarke integrierte PHP-Entwicklungsumgebung

Dreamweaver CS6
Visuelle Webentwicklungstools

SublimeText3 Mac-Version
Codebearbeitungssoftware auf Gottesniveau (SublimeText3)

Heiße Themen



Git ist ein Versionskontrollsystem, und GitHub ist eine GIT-basierte Code-Hosting-Plattform. Git wird verwendet, um Codeversionen zu verwalten und unterstützt lokale Operationen. GitHub bietet Online -Zusammenarbeitstools wie das Problem mit der Ausgabe und PullRequest.

Git und Github sind nicht dasselbe. Git ist ein Versionskontrollsystem, und GitHub ist eine GIT-basierte Code-Hosting-Plattform. Git wird verwendet, um Codeversionen zu verwalten, und GitHub bietet eine Online -Zusammenarbeit.

Github ist nicht schwer zu lernen. 1) Meister Sie das Grundwissen: GitHub ist ein GIT-basiertes Versionskontrollsystem, mit dem Code Änderungen und kollaborative Entwicklung nachverfolgt werden. 2) Kernfunktionen verstehen: Versionskontrolle zeichnet jede Einreichung, die Unterstützung lokaler Arbeiten und Remote -Synchronisation auf. 3) Lernen Sie, wie Sie verwendet werden: vom Erstellen eines Repositorys bis hin zum Drücken von Commits bis hin zur Verwendung von Zweigen und Ziehenanforderungen. 4) Lösen Sie gemeinsame Probleme: wie Zusammenführungskonflikte und Vergessen, Dateien hinzuzufügen. 5) Optimierungspraxis: Verwenden Sie aussagekräftige Einreichungsnachrichten, Reinigen Sie Niederlassungen und Verwalten Sie Aufgaben mithilfe der Projektplatine. Durch Praxis und Community -Kommunikation ist Githubs Lernkurve nicht steil.

In Ihrem Lebenslauf sollten Sie sich dafür entscheiden, Git oder GitHub basierend auf Ihren Positionsanforderungen und persönlichen Erfahrungen zu schreiben. 1. Wenn die Position GIT -Fähigkeiten erfordert, markieren Sie Git. 2. Wenn die Position der Positionsbeteiligung bewertet, zeigen Sie GitHub. 3. Beschreiben Sie die Nutzungserfahrung und die Projektfälle im Detail und beenden Sie einen vollständigen Satz.

Microsoft besitzt keinen Git, sondern besitzt GitHub. 1.Git ist ein verteiltes Versionskontrollsystem, das 2005 von Linus Torvaz erstellt wurde. 2. GitHub ist eine Online -Code -Hosting -Plattform, die auf Git basiert. Es wurde 2008 gegründet und 2018 von Microsoft übernommen.

Der Grund für die Verwendung von GitHub zur Verwaltung von HTML -Projekten ist, dass es eine Plattform für die Versionskontrolle, die kollaborative Entwicklung und die Präsentation von Werken bietet. Zu den spezifischen Schritten gehören: 1. Erstellen und initialisieren Sie das Git -Repository, 2. HTML -Dateien hinzufügen und senden. Darüber hinaus unterstützt GitHub auch Funktionen für die Code -Überprüfung, Ausgabe und PullRequest, um HTML -Projekte zu optimieren und zusammenzuarbeiten.

Git ist ein Open -Source -Distributed -Versionskontrollsystem, mit dem Entwickler die Änderungen der Dateien verfolgen, zusammenarbeiten und Codeversionen verwalten können. Zu den Kernfunktionen gehören: 1) Modifikationen auf Datensätze, 2) Fallback in frühere Versionen, 3) kollaborative Entwicklung und 4) Niederlassungen für parallele Entwicklung erstellen und verwalten.

Ausgehend von Git eignet sich besser für ein tiefes Verständnis der Prinzipien der Versionskontrolle. Ausgehend von GitHub eignet sich besser für die Konzentration auf Zusammenarbeit und Code -Hosting. 1.Git ist ein verteiltes Versionskontrollsystem, mit dem die Code -Versionsverlauf verwaltet wird. 2. GitHub ist eine Online -Plattform, die auf Git basiert und die Funktionen für Code -Hosting und Kollaboration bietet.
